A geoscientist specializes in studying geosciences and performing research and analysis. Typically, their responsibilities revolve around crafting research plans, conducting field mapping and studies to examine geological structures, gathering samples, obtaining photographic evidence, and conducting different experiments and scientific studies. As a geoscientist, it is essential to maintain an extensive record of data, summarize results in reports and presentations, and collaborate with different scientists. They may publish their studies in various publications, utilize them for other projects and programs, or raise public awareness.
